Skip to content

Commit

Permalink
v3(services) GA service route bindings (cloudfoundry#1978)
Browse files Browse the repository at this point in the history
* v3(services) GA service route bindings

[#175559034](https://www.pivotaltracker.com/story/show/175559034)

* v3(services) Added test for `/v3`
  • Loading branch information
FelisiaM authored Dec 2, 2020
1 parent 4dc219d commit 8c07baf
Show file tree
Hide file tree
Showing 11 changed files with 18 additions and 9 deletions.
2 changes: 2 additions & 0 deletions app/controllers/v3/root_controller.rb
Original file line number Diff line number Diff line change
Expand Up @@ -28,8 +28,10 @@ def v3_root
links.merge!(create_link(:security_groups))
links.merge!(create_link(:service_brokers))
links.merge!(create_link(:service_instances, experimental: true))
links.merge!(create_link(:service_credential_bindings, experimental: true))
links.merge!(create_link(:service_offerings))
links.merge!(create_link(:service_plans))
links.merge!(create_link(:service_route_bindings))
links.merge!(create_link(:service_usage_events))
links.merge!(create_link(:spaces))
links.merge!(create_link(:space_quotas))
Expand Down
18 changes: 9 additions & 9 deletions docs/v3/source/index.html.md
Original file line number Diff line number Diff line change
Expand Up @@ -291,7 +291,15 @@ includes:
- resources/service_plan_visibility/get
- resources/service_plan_visibility/update
- resources/service_plan_visibility/apply
- resources/service_plan_visibility/delete
- resources/service_plan_visibility/delete
- resources/service_route_bindings/header
- resources/service_route_bindings/object
- resources/service_route_bindings/get
- resources/service_route_bindings/list
- resources/service_route_bindings/create
- resources/service_route_bindings/update
- resources/service_route_bindings/delete
- resources/service_route_bindings/parameters
- resources/service_usage_events/header
- resources/service_usage_events/object
- resources/service_usage_events/get
Expand Down Expand Up @@ -364,14 +372,6 @@ includes:
- experimental_resources/service_credential_bindings/delete
- experimental_resources/service_credential_bindings/details
- experimental_resources/service_credential_bindings/parameters
- experimental_resources/service_route_bindings/header
- experimental_resources/service_route_bindings/object
- experimental_resources/service_route_bindings/get
- experimental_resources/service_route_bindings/list
- experimental_resources/service_route_bindings/create
- experimental_resources/service_route_bindings/update
- experimental_resources/service_route_bindings/delete
- experimental_resources/service_route_bindings/parameters
- experimental_resources/service_instances/header
- experimental_resources/service_instances/create
- experimental_resources/service_instances/get
Expand Down
7 changes: 7 additions & 0 deletions spec/request/v3_root_spec.rb
Original file line number Diff line number Diff line change
Expand Up @@ -77,12 +77,19 @@
'href' => "#{link_prefix}/v3/service_instances",
'experimental' => true
},
'service_credential_bindings' => {
'href' => "#{link_prefix}/v3/service_credential_bindings",
'experimental' => true
},
'service_offerings' => {
'href' => "#{link_prefix}/v3/service_offerings"
},
'service_plans' => {
'href' => "#{link_prefix}/v3/service_plans"
},
'service_route_bindings' => {
'href' => "#{link_prefix}/v3/service_route_bindings"
},
'service_usage_events' => {
'href' => "#{link_prefix}/v3/service_usage_events"
},
Expand Down

0 comments on commit 8c07baf

Please sign in to comment.